Title: EVIDENCE OF THE IMPORTANCE OF JUVENILE HORMONE FOR FLIGHT IN SOLENOPSIS INVICTA FEMALE ALATES AND THE INFLUENCE OF MATING IN POST-NUPTIAL FLIGHT DEALATION

Technical Abstract: Juvenile hormone appears to be important in stimulating Solenopsis invicta female alates to engage in a nuptial flight. Alates that were topically treated with 100æg precocene II did not display typical pre-flight behaviors. These behaviors consist of alates ascending from the mound and climbing onto nearby vegetation. In addition, tethered precocene-treated alates could not be induced to fly. Behaviors associated with a nuptial flight were examined in untreated female alates to determine whether one or a combination of behaviors contributes to post-mating dealation. Pre- copulatory behaviors investigated were 1) excited alates scurrying on the surface of the soil, 2) excited alates climbing onto vegetation, 3) tethered alates flying for 5min but not primed for a nuptial flight, and 4) alates displaying all of the described pre-mating behaviors. The time in which these alates were induced to shed their wings was significantly longer than that of just-mated female alates. Mating, alone or in combination with other behaviors and/or environmental cues, may be a major factor inducing dealation.
